Miscellaneous Commercial ServicesCommercial Services Part of CME Group, Inc., CME Trade Repository Ltd. is a derivatives marketplace that offers a wide range of futures and options products for risk management. Founded in 2013, the company is based in London, UK. The British company's services include short-term, limited risk contracts, equity index futures and options, and exchange-agnostic services to reduce systemic or counterparty risk throughout the trade lifecycle. The company also provides educational materials, reports, and analysis on market events and CME Group products.
